购物商城界面功能全览:轮播图、注册登录及购物车
版权申诉
5星 · 超过95%的资源 8 浏览量
更新于2024-10-03
1
收藏 4.8MB RAR 举报
资源摘要信息:"第16章_购物商城_"
1. 购物商城界面设计:
购物商城界面设计关注的是用户体验和视觉呈现。一个好看的界面对于吸引和保持用户至关重要。设计元素通常包括清晰的导航栏、轮播图、商品展示、用户交互按钮等。在代码完备的前提下,商城界面设计还需要考虑到响应式设计,以适应不同尺寸的屏幕和设备。此外,设计上还会强调品牌元素和色彩的运用,以及清晰的商品分类和搜索功能,使用户能够快速找到所需商品。
2. 功能实现:
购物商城的功能实现涉及到前端与后端的协同工作。前端负责展示和用户交互,而后端负责数据处理和业务逻辑。
- 轮播图功能:
轮播图是商城首页常见的功能,用于展示最新、热门或推荐商品。实现轮播图功能通常需要使用JavaScript(或其框架如Vue.js、React等)、CSS以及HTML。轮播图可以通过定时器自动切换图片和内容,同时提供用户手动切换图片的功能。
- 登陆注册功能:
用户登陆注册功能是商城的基础功能之一,它涉及到用户数据的管理和保护。通常需要实现表单验证、密码加密存储、会话管理等安全措施。现代的Web应用可能会使用OAuth、JWT(JSON Web Tokens)等技术来处理用户认证和授权。
- 悬浮搜索框:
悬浮搜索框是提高用户体验的一种设计方式,它可以让用户在不跳转页面的情况下快速搜索商品。实现悬浮搜索框需要对HTML、CSS进行相应的布局和样式设计,以及JavaScript用于处理用户的搜索请求和显示搜索结果。
- 购物车功能:
购物车功能是电子商务平台的核心功能之一,它允许用户查看和管理他们选定购买的商品。购物车通常需要与后端数据库紧密配合,以存储用户添加到购物车中的商品信息。前端需要有动态更新购物车商品数量和总金额的功能,后端则负责处理结算、库存管理和订单生成等逻辑。
3. 购物商城的技术栈:
购物商城的开发通常会使用一系列的技术栈来实现上述功能,包括但不限于:
- 前端技术:HTML, CSS, JavaScript, 可能还会用到一些前端框架如React, Vue.js, Angular等。
- 后端技术:Node.js, Python (Django, Flask), Java (Spring), PHP (Laravel) 等。
- 数据库:MySQL, PostgreSQL, MongoDB, Redis等。
- 服务器与部署:Nginx, Apache, AWS, Heroku, Docker等。
4. 代码完备性:
一个代码完备的购物商城意味着其代码具有良好的结构、注释、文档和遵循最佳实践。这不仅包括前端的代码,也包括后端API的设计和数据库的结构。代码完备的商城易于维护、扩展和部署。
通过以上知识点的分析,可以看出构建一个功能完备、界面美观的购物商城是一个复杂而系统的过程,涉及到前端设计与开发、后端架构设计、数据库管理以及安全措施的实施等多个方面。随着技术的发展,商城系统的设计和实现也在不断进步,以适应不断变化的市场需求和技术趋势。
2022-01-03 上传
2024-06-17 上传
2021-09-06 上传
2024-04-02 上传
2008-09-13 上传
2021-03-24 上传
2022-11-20 上传
2010-02-03 上传
2023-08-18 上传
weixin_42668301
- 粉丝: 652
- 资源: 3993
最新资源
- MATLAB新功能:Multi-frame ViewRGB制作彩色图阴影
- XKCD Substitutions 3-crx插件:创新的网页文字替换工具
- Python实现8位等离子效果开源项目plasma.py解读
- 维护商店移动应用:基于PhoneGap的移动API应用
- Laravel-Admin的Redis Manager扩展使用教程
- Jekyll代理主题使用指南及文件结构解析
- cPanel中PHP多版本插件的安装与配置指南
- 深入探讨React和Typescript在Alias kopio游戏中的应用
- node.js OSC服务器实现:Gibber消息转换技术解析
- 体验最新升级版的mdbootstrap pro 6.1.0组件库
- 超市盘点过机系统实现与delphi应用
- Boogle: 探索 Python 编程的 Boggle 仿制品
- C++实现的Physics2D简易2D物理模拟
- 傅里叶级数在分数阶微分积分计算中的应用与实现
- Windows Phone与PhoneGap应用隔离存储文件访问方法
- iso8601-interval-recurrence:掌握ISO8601日期范围与重复间隔检查